Cordova was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their eighth straight defeat. They had to suffer through a 75-8 loss at the hands of the Grant Pacers. The game marked the Lancers' lowest-scoring contest so far this season.
Grant found their leader in sophomore Asia Washington, who dropped a double-double on 24 points and 12 rebounds. Washington has been hot for a while, having posted eight or more boards the last 15 times she's played. Oranell Latham was another key player, almost dropping a double-double on nine points and ten rebounds.
Cordova's loss dropped their record down to 4-18. As for Grant, the victory made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 15-7.
Cordova is taking a road trip to square off against West Park at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Cordova is facing West Park at the right time seeing as West Park is stuck on a four-game losing streak. As for Grant, they will have some time to savor their win since their next game is a little ways off: they'll take on Kennedy at 7:00 p.m. on January 31st.
